It all started with a glass yogurt jar, Mod Podge, embellishing glue, vintage lace, flower trim, and some old jewelry. Some Mod Podge was applied to the clean jar with a foam brush. The netting (that was with the lace) was applied first and allowed to dry. Another layer of Mod Podge was brushed on and the vintage lace was applied over the netting.
